Jess Gillam Ensemble
Jess Gillam EnsemblePresented by Saffron Hall
Superstar saxophonist Jess Gillam and her hand-picked ensemble radiate a joy and warmth in their music-making.
They cover music from across the globe and in all styles, performed with an intuitive rapport and dazzling musicianship. With plenty of festive favourites thrown in, their special Christmas concerts are a joyous, freewheeling playlist. Prior to the concert Jess and members of the ensemble will be spending three days working with students from Saffron Walden County High School.

Programme and performers
Programme
- Tchaikovsky arr. Simon Parkin Nutcracker Suite 3 mins
- trad/Corelli/Vivaldi et al arr. Poxon/Parkin La Folia 8 mins
- Holst arr. Benjamin Rimmer In the Bleak Midwinter 2 mins
- Trad arr. Benjamin Rimmer Coventry Carol 2 mins
- Franz Xaver Gruber arr. Benjamin Rimmer/Alex Maydew Silent Night 2.5 mins
- Mykola Leontovych arr. Simon Parkin Carol of the Bells 3 mins
- Barbara Strozzi arr. Alistair Vennart Che si puo fare 4 mins
- Trad arr. JGE/Simon Parkin Yuletide Comes 3 mins
- Adolphe Adam arr. Alistair Vennart O Holy Night 2.5 mins
- Sidney Bechet sax part transcr. Lolo Garcia/arr. Sam Becker Petite Fleur 2.5 mins
- Barbara Thompson A Tribute to Bechet 2.5 mins
- Vivaldi arr. Simon Parkin Winter 3 mins
- Irving Berlin arr. Kristina Arakelyan White Christmas 3 mins
- Pedro Itturalde arr. John Harle Pequena Czarda 4 mins
- Michael Nyman Chasing sheep is best left to Shepherd 3 mins
- Sammy Cahn and Jimmy Van Heusen Secret of Christmas 3 mins
- Rune Sorensen arr. Simon Parkin/JGE Shine you no more 4 mins
